I've been reading lots and lots of manga lately, as Alex tends to buy lots of it. I just finished reading the first book of Angelic Layer, and it amused me greatly. For those of you who don't know, Angelic Layer is put out by a manga company called CLAMP. CLAMP also did a manga called Magic Knight Rayearth, which I have also read. What amused me was that Angelic Layer shows the main character, Misaki, talking about a "manga [she] read on the train," which starred a young girl named Hikaru. The picture showed Hikaru from behind--and, of course, it was Hikaru from Magic Knight Rayearth. CLAMP refers to its other mangas while amusing us. I love it.
